court of equity
often capitalized C&E
    
            
                
                
                
        
                                                    
                                
              
          
                                                      : a court having jurisdiction over suits in equity and administering justice and providing remedies according to the rules and principles of equity   compare court of law                                      
                
Note: Rule 2 of the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ure abolishes the distinction between law and equity, and therefore there are no longer courts of equity in the federal system.
